Output fbf26333034dfc16d12294d860fb40b19482cb9b0d99a81030197f84203b47fd:1

value
131378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 843a5a92a800bc55d0ca7bc474613f05d887fbb3 OP_EQUAL
address
3DkB2MkE7aB1E4GzM9XRnPPEjq6ko6WwgD
transaction
fbf26333034dfc16d12294d860fb40b19482cb9b0d99a81030197f84203b47fd
confirmations
231475
spent
true